1-man shop hits $425k revenue in first year, highlighting high leverage
teodorio · x · 2026-08-25
- Claims being a one-man shop is the highest leverage move right now, potentially 5-10x'ing income.
- Cites a case where a developer made $425k in the first year as a solo shop in an unsexy niche.
- Emphasizes that tech work is location agnostic, allowing global US-level earnings while living anywhere.
